Output 843a786d7284e2a4bc64a6e6d5feff3dc156dc8641d841cfb5c553e8a92dafe8:24

value
27172
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70a6d3ff87131a51b2c8bcd7a867eaeba30f669a OP_EQUAL
address
3BxfTT2hHXvRkDhTSKANANqYSwiyorc2eh
transaction
843a786d7284e2a4bc64a6e6d5feff3dc156dc8641d841cfb5c553e8a92dafe8
spent
true